Former NCC, Beautify Barbados workers summoned to meeting

THE NATIONAL UNION of Public Workers is summoning all retrenched National Conservation Commission (NCC) and Beautify Barbados workers to an emergency general meeting on Friday.

Acting general secretary Wayne Walrond said the union wished to update the workers on various issues.

“The meeting is being called to update the NCC workers on the union’s position in light of the impending decision of the employment rights tribunal and will also update the Beautify Barbados workers about the status of outstanding vacation leave and claims for gratuity payment.”

The meeting will take place in the union’s Horatio Cooke Auditorium at 10 a.m. (CA)
